第二章《注重实效的途径》
“重复的危害”提醒不要在系统各处对知识进行重复。
“正交性”提醒不要把任何一项知识分散在多个系统组件中。
“可撤销性”将考察有助于项目与其不断变化的环境绝缘的一些技术。
“曳光弹”提供了一种开发方式。
“原型与便签”提出了在曳光弹开发不适用的情况下,怎样使用原型来测试架构、算法、接口以及各种想法。
本章内容与我们的团队项目相结合,我发现我们团队项目中有很多重复的知识,明明可以把它写成一个函数在不同地方调用,结果我们并没有这么做,导致代码变多,程序运行慢。
阅读完本章后我们团队对项目进行了优化,将重复的地方写成了函数进行调用。